进位信号是一种在数字电路中非常重要的信号。它代表了在数字加法器中,由于对于同一位的两个输入数的和可能超出了该位所能表达的范围,从而向更高一位产生的进位信号。那么,进位信号是如何产生的呢?从以下几个方面详细阐述:
在数字加法器电路中,一个二进制加法器一般都会有两个输出:进位输出和和输出。其中,和输出就是两个数相加得到的结果,而进位输出是在最高位相加时,如果产生了进位,则输出1,否则输出0。因此,产生进位信号就是指在这种最高位相加时发生进位的情况。
要理解进位信号产生的原理,需要先了解二进制加法的原理。在二进制加法中,每一位的和都是通过对应位的两个二进制数和该位的进位来计算得到的。例如,对于两个4位的二进制数1010和1101,它们相加的结果为:
1 0 1 0
+ 1 1 0 1
---------
1 0 1 1
其中,每一位的计算规则如下:
在二进制加法器中,当两个同位二进制数相加时,如果产生了进位(也就是最高位相加结果为1),那么就需要将该进位信号输出到高位,以便后续的计算。例如,将两个4位的二进制数1010和1101相加得到的结果1011中,进位信号为1,表明最高位进了1,需要将该进位信号输出到下一位的运算中。
因此,进位信号的产生是由于最高位相加可能会产生进位,这个进位需要向更高一位输出,以便后续的计算。
进位生成和进位传递是二进制加法器的两个主要方面。二进制加法器能够完成加法运算,靠的是它的进位生成和进位传递能力。进位传递包括两个部分:进位延迟和进位产生。进位延迟指进位信号在状态位之间传递的延迟时间,也就是进位信号从产生开始到它所有的和位和进位位都使用完毕的时间。进位延迟时间主要受加法器的结构和逻辑延迟时间的影响。